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
078 6200155 730506377 2182995423 31019933
562 1407231762
562 1407231762
75029 812 097
All about undefined
Interested in learning more?
562 1407231762
75029 812 097
See more
324165 91525135
9323608116 152 978314637
See more
54449 28507537 01
7415540 147578 91227611318 47330834780 429
See more